I WON AGAIN!! for this move, I HIGHLY recommend you don't do it how I did in the video. In my video I spun the ball above my head looking up at it. Only do this if you have a stage ball or are very experienced, as you don't want to drop an acrylic on your face. It's hard to explain how to do it safely with an acrylic, so I made a video. Notice how I'm standing to the side, that way you can see that the ball stays in front of me the whole time. I also threw in a little silent tutorial for the move.

Ahh, took me a while to see what you were saying, but I see it now. In the submission video, I did what I did in the tutorial video, then did a half folding line by doing a forearm roll, switch to outside elbow, then back arm roll into a cradle.

That's just a transition I use to keep the flow going, and I'd suggest you learn it because it's an amazing transition and I use it for a lot of tricks. But the arm spiral itself is what I do in the tutorial video.
